Q: Is 126,633,324 a Prime Number?
A: No, 126,633,324 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 126633324 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 4 6 12 53 106 159 212 318 636 199,109 398,218 597,327 796,436 1,194,654 2,389,308 10,552,777 21,105,554 31,658,331 42,211,108 63,316,662 and 126,633,324, with no remainder.
Since 126,633,324 cannot be divided by just 1 and 126,633,324, it is not a prime number.
